Agile modeling
Agile Modeling is a practice-based methodology for modeling and documentation of software-based systems. It is intended to be a collection of values, principles, and practices for modeling software that can be applied on a software development project in a more flexible manner than traditional modeling methods.
Agile Modeling is a supplement to other Agile methodologies such as:Agile Modeling best practices:
Agile Modeling is a supplement to other Agile methodologies such as:Agile Modeling best practices:
- TDD
- Executable Specifications
- Iteration Modeling
- Model Storming
- Requirements Envisioning
- Just Barely Good Enough
- Document Late
- Multiple Models
- Single Source Information
- Architecture Envisioning
- Document Continuously
- Model a bit Ahead
- Prioritized Requirements
- Active Stakeholders Participation

